The Dermatology & Holloware 6″ Alexander-Farabeuf Costal Periostome – Pediatric is a specialized surgical instrument developed for precise periosteal dissection and rib exposure procedures requiring enhanced control in smaller anatomical structures. Designed specifically for pediatric applications, this compact periostome provides surgeons with the accuracy and maneuverability needed during delicate thoracic, orthopedic, and reconstructive surgeries.
The Alexander-Farabeuf Costal Periostome is widely recognized as a reliable instrument for elevating the periosteum from bone surfaces while maintaining controlled tissue handling. The pediatric version features a smaller 6-inch design that allows improved access and manipulation in pediatric patients where precision and gentle handling are essential. Its carefully shaped working end supports smooth separation of periosteal tissue while helping reduce unnecessary trauma to surrounding structures.

This surgical periosteal elevator is commonly used in pediatric thoracic procedures, chest wall surgeries, rib-related interventions, and reconstructive applications. It may also support procedures where controlled periosteal elevation is required for bone preparation or surgical access.
